Interactions in aquatic food webs (IRTA)

Leader : Alexandre Bec

Our research aims to assess how local and global constraints affect the functioning of aquatic ecosystems. We mainly focus on the microbe-metazoan interface where the high variability in energy and matter transfer efficiency impact ecosystem structure and productivity.

Research themes: 

  • Local and global drivers of aquatic microbial communities (with a focus on cyanobacteria)
  • Functional importance of detrital food webs
  • Fluctuating thermal and nutritional constraints on aquatic consumers
  • Integration of nutritional and metabolic ecology
  • Resiliance of aquatic ecosystems
